Variant summary

Our verdict is Likely benign. Variant got -4 ACMG points: 2P and 6B. PM4BP6_ModerateBS2

The NM_007332.3(TRPA1):c.2755C>T(p.Arg919Ter) variant causes a stop gained change. The variant allele was found at a frequency of 0.000221 in 1,613,802 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ely benign (★). Variant results in nonsense mediated mRNA decay.

Genes affected
TRPA1 (HGNC:497): (transient receptor potential cation channel subfamily A member 1) The structure of the protein encoded by this gene is highly related to both the protein ankyrin and transmembrane proteins. The specific function of this protein has not yet been determined; however, studies indicate the function may involve a role in signal transduction and growth control. [provided by RefSeq, Jul 2008]
